KPSQ Fayetteville 97.3FM KPSQ-LP Fayetteville 97.3FM: Community Powered Radio. Tune in and join the conversation! 📻🎶 We are frequently adding new shows created by you, the community!

Since we began broadcasting in May of 2016, our fantastic volunteers and local show producers have kept the station running, currently airing over 20 locally produced shows, and selecting great music, news, and public affairs programming from Pacifica, the country's first listener supported network. Our pride and joy are the locally produced music shows, from indie to rock, to reggae, and world mu

sic, we cover it all. We are also playing some great "genre" music from the KPSQ Music Library that you won't hear on any other stations. KPSQ is Arkansas’ only Pacifica Radio Network Affiliate, and one of only two radio stations in Arkansas to broadcast the acclaimed news show "Democracy Now". Our Mission Statement: KPSQ features locally produced programming and presents cultural, artistic, and political perspectives currently underrepresented in the media. Our goal is to inform and empower listeners to play an active role in our radio station and in the community. Our programming promotes equality, peace, sustainability, democracy, and social and economic justice.
